summaryrefslogtreecommitdiffhomepage
path: root/themes/openwrt.org
diff options
context:
space:
mode:
Diffstat (limited to 'themes/openwrt.org')
-rw-r--r--themes/openwrt.org/luasrc/view/themes/openwrt.org/header.htm12
1 files changed, 4 insertions, 8 deletions
diff --git a/themes/openwrt.org/luasrc/view/themes/openwrt.org/header.htm b/themes/openwrt.org/luasrc/view/themes/openwrt.org/header.htm
index f18d0bce39..5c354d5b49 100644
--- a/themes/openwrt.org/luasrc/view/themes/openwrt.org/header.htm
+++ b/themes/openwrt.org/luasrc/view/themes/openwrt.org/header.htm
@@ -119,20 +119,16 @@ end
</div>
<%
if "admin" == request[1] then
- require("luci.model.uci")
local ucic = 0
- local changes = luci.model.uci.changes()
- if type(changes) == "table" then -- XXX: sometimes string or nil / needs investigation
- for n, s in pairs(changes) do
- for no, o in pairs(s) do
- ucic = ucic + 1;
- end
+ for n, s in pairs(require("luci.model.uci").changes()) do
+ for no, o in pairs(s) do
+ ucic = ucic + 1;
end
end
%>
<div><%:config Konfiguration%>
<ul>
- <% if ucic then %>
+ <% if ucic > 0 then %>
<li><a href="<%=controller%>/admin/uci/changes"><%:changes Ă„nderungen%>: <%=ucic%></a></li>
<li><a href="<%=controller%>/admin/uci/apply"><%:apply Anwenden%></a></li>
<li><a href="<%=controller%>/admin/uci/revert"><%:revert Verwerfen%></a></li>